Engine & Performance

The 2025 Maruti Suzuki Invicto is engineered to deliver a perfect blend of power, efficiency, and refinement. Under the hood, it is expected to feature a robust 2.0L petrol-hybrid engine, offering a smooth yet responsive driving experience. The hybrid technology ensures improved fuel efficiency while reducing emissions, making it an eco-friendly choice in the MPV segment.

Paired with an advanced e-CVT automatic transmission, the Invicto provides seamless acceleration and effortless cruising on highways. Its well-tuned suspension ensures a comfortable ride, even on rough roads, while the electronic power steering enhances maneuverability in city traffic. Whether you’re driving in urban conditions or on long highway stretches, the 2025 Invicto promises a refined, fuel-efficient, and enjoyable performance.


Technology & Safety Features

The 2025 Maruti Suzuki Invicto is packed with advanced technology and cutting-edge safety features, ensuring a connected and secure driving experience. At the heart of its tech offerings is a large touchscreen infotainment system with w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, providing seamless smartphone integration. A fully digital instrument cluster, voice command support, and connected car features enhance convenience, while a premium sound system delivers an immersive audio experience.

On the safety front, the Invicto is equipped with a robust suite of features, including multiple airbags, ABS with EBD, electronic stability control (ESC), and a 360-degree camera for effortless parking. Adv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) such as ad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and automatic emergency braking further elevate passenger protection. With a strong body structure and modern safety tech, the 2025 Invicto ensures peace of mind on every journey.


Expected Variants & Pricing

The 2025 Maruti Suzuki Invicto is expected to be available in multiple variants, catering to different customer needs. The lineup may include a base variant with essential features, a mid-range variant with enhanced technology and comfort, and a top-end variant offering premium luxury and adv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S){5}{6}.

As for pricing, the Invicto is likely to be positioned competitively in the premium MPV segment. The expected price range could start from ₹25 lakh for the base model and go up to ₹30–32 lakh for the fully loaded top-end variant (ex-showroom). With its premium features, hybrid powertrain, and Maruti Suzuki’s reliability, the Invicto is set to offer excellent value for money in the luxury MPV market{7}{8}.

Comparison with Rivals

The 2025 Maruti Suzuki Invicto enters the luxury MPV segment, competing against established rivals like the Toyota Innova Hycross, Kia Carnival, and MG Gloster. Here’s how it stacks up:

  • Maruti Suzuki Invicto vs. Toyota Innova Hycross
    The Invicto shares its platform with the Innova Hycross but offers a more premium and feature-rich experience under the NEXA branding. Both come with hybrid powertrains, but the Invicto is expected to focus more on luxury and technology-driven features.
  • Maruti Suzuki Invicto vs. Kia Carnival
    The Kia Carnival offers a more spacious cabin with a more powerful diesel engine. However, the Invicto’s hybrid setup ensures better fuel efficiency, making it a more economical choice for long-term ownership{11}{12}.
  • Maruti Suzuki Invicto vs. MG Gloster
    The MG Gloster, being a full-size SUV, offers more off-road capabilities and diesel engine options. However, the Invicto shines with its hybrid efficiency, advanced tech, and Maruti Suzuki’s trusted service network.

With premium features, hybrid efficiency, and competitive pricing, the Invicto stands out as a strong contender in the luxury MPV space, catering to buyers who seek a balance of comfort, performance, and cost-effectiveness.
